Subject: [RFC PATCH 12/32] function_graph: Move set_graph_function tests to shadow stack global var
Date: Mon, 6 Nov 2023 01:08:56 +0900 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<169920053652.482486.2956196897000211800.stgit@devnote2>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<169920038849.482486.15796387219966662967.stgit@devnote2>
From: Steven Rostedt (VMware) <rostedt@goodmis.org>
The use of the task->trace_recursion for the logic used for the
set_graph_funnction was a bit of an abuse of that variable. Now that there
exists global vars that are per stack for registered graph traces, use that
instead.
